Block walls serve both functional and visual purposes in landscaping, providing structure, personal privacy, and visual interest to outside areas. These walls can be used to retain soil on sloped homes, specify garden beds, or produce clear limits within a landscape. The option of block type-- concrete, interlocking, or ornamental-- affects both the strength and appearance of the wall. Proper preparation makes sure stability, especially for taller walls, with factors to consider for drainage, support, and soil pressure. Installation starts with a well-prepared base, typically involving excavation and leveling to ensure the wall remains straight and stable over time. Mortar or adhesive might be used depending upon the block type, and support like rebar can boost sturdiness. A experienced landscaper guarantees each course is level and aligned, avoiding future shifting or cracking. Block walls also provide imaginative opportunities through surfaces, textures, and colors, permitting them to complement the surrounding landscape. Incorporating lighting, planters, or cascading plants can soften the difficult edges, making the wall both useful and aesthetically appealing. Routine examinations and small repair work help maintain the wall's integrity for several years to come
